What Makes It Sell—Beyond Just Being “Cute”

Multicolored Snowflake succeeds where many Christmas embroidery files falter: it balances visual impact with production practicality. At a glance, shoppers understand it’s seasonal—but not *only* seasonal. That multicolor palette subtly extends its shelf life into late fall and early January gifting. On Etsy listings, it photographs with exceptional clarity—even under soft booth lighting—because the contrast between thread colors creates natural depth. As a digital embroidery file, it’s highly repeatable for batch production: consistent stitch density, no micro-details that snag or skip, and no tiny lettering or fragile filigree to compromise quality at scale.

Careful-Use Notes Every Designer Should Check

Don’t assume “fun and easy to stitch” means zero prep. Before cutting your first fabric, test these:

  1. Dense stitch areas: Some inner snowflake arms layer multiple color fills. On thick fabrics (like heavy denim aprons), use a firm cutaway + topping combo to prevent puckering.
  2. Fabric texture: Avoid high-pile terrycloth or heavily brushed flannel—details blur. Stick to smooth-weave cotton, linen blends, or midweight twill.
  3. Dark fabric: The multicolor effect relies on thread brightness. On charcoal or navy, confirm your thread palette includes high-contrast options (e.g., lime, coral, buttercup) rather than relying only on pastels.
  4. Small sizes: Below 2.75", subtle color transitions begin to merge. Reserve sub-3" versions strictly for patches or small pouch accents—not primary booth displays.
